Discipleship
“I have hidden your word in my heart, that I might not sin against you.” Psalms 119:11
“For the word of God is alive and powerful. It is sharper than the sharpest two-edged sword, cutting between soul and spirit, between joint and marrow. It exposes our innermost thoughts and desires.” Hebrews 4:12
When we are discipled, we are to become like Jesus.
And, only God’s word can change us but not on the outside but from the inside out.
One of the requirements to become a disciple is deny self
“No one can serve two masters. For you will hate one and love the other; you will be devoted to one and despise the other. You cannot serve God and be enslaved to money. Matthew 6:24
If God is to rule in our lives, then our will must be made submissive to His. We must be willing to give up anything in life in order to please God.
"And so, dear brothers and sisters, I plead with you to give your bodies to God because of all he has done for you. Let them be a living and holy sacrifice—the kind he will find acceptable. This is truly the way to worship him. Don’t copy the behavior and customs of this world, but let God transform you into a new person by changing the way you think. Then you will learn to know God’s will for you, which is good and pleasing and perfect." Romans 12:1-2
"Seek the Kingdom of God above all else, and live righteously, and he will give you everything you need." Matthew 6:33
